# Break-Glass: Catalog Cache Invalidation

Scope: the Pinrow product catalog at Veldstone Retail. If stale prices persist after a purge and the Hollowmere invalidation queue is wedged, use break-glass to flush the edge tier directly. Contractors: get verbal sign-off from the catalog lead first. Steps: open the Hollowmere admin shell, select emergency-flush, confirm the tenant, and run it once — repeated flushes thrash the origin. Access is logged and expires after 20 minutes. Unseal the admin shell with the passphrase below.

recovery phrase for kahop-tajog: istix-casvan

Our ingest service polls the Garvey Street garage sensors every fifteen seconds and publishes per-level counts to the downstream dashboard consumed by the city pilot. Before running it locally, copy env.sample to .env and review each entry carefully: the poll interval, the garage identifier (use GRV-04 for staging), and the retry ceiling of five. Miscounts usually trace back to a stale cache, so clear it on first boot. Directly after the retry ceiling line, append the feed signing secret on its own line.

sealed setting: ARCHIVE_KEY3=8d0

**Runbook: account recovery — Largediff admin**

Applies when the Largediff service account (big-file diff viewer) is locked after failed token refreshes. Verify the requester is on the support roster, then open the recovery console and select the Largediff tenant. Enter the passphrase below when prompted.

vault phrase of bagaf-kajeg = jorath-feniel-briir-siliel-ralix